How can I request a municipal solvency certificate in Guatemala?

To request a municipal solvency certificate in Guatemala, you must go to the corresponding municipality and submit an application, providing the required information, such as the taxpayer's name, identification number, address, meet the requirements established by the municipality and pay the fees. corresponding. The municipality will issue the certificate of solvency once the process is completed.

What happens if the debtor does not comply with the embargo in Brazil?

If the debtor does not comply with the garnishment, the creditor can ask the court for additional measures to ensure payment of the debt. These measures may include the forced execution of seized assets, the inclusion of the debtor in defaulter registers and the restriction of their credit capacity.

What is the responsibility of older siblings in cases of food debt in Colombia?

In Colombia, the responsibility of older siblings in cases of child support debt is generally not legally established. The main obligation falls on the parents. However, in exceptional situations, a court may consider the financial ability of older siblings to contribute to the well-being of younger siblings. This is usually done by evaluating the situation holistically and considering the specific needs of the family.

What implications does regulatory compliance have in the supply chain of companies in Chile?

Regulatory compliance in the supply chain is critical for companies in Chile. They must evaluate and ensure that their suppliers comply with applicable laws and regulations. Lack of compliance in the supply chain can expose companies to legal risks and reputational damage, so they must establish due diligence and control processes.

Can people challenge the accuracy of their judicial records in El Salvador?

Yes, people can challenge the accuracy of their judicial records in El Salvador if they find incorrect or outdated information in their records. To do so, they must submit a request to the Judicial Branch or the competent authority, providing evidence to support their request for correction. The courts will review the request and, if warranted, take action to correct the erroneous information.

What are the legal consequences of extracontractual civil liability in Ecuador?

Extracontractual civil liability, also known as liability for damages, is regulated in Ecuador and may entail economic sanctions and the obligation to repair the damage caused. This regulation seeks to compensate victims for damages suffered due to the unlawful conduct of another person.
